Wastewater Permitting | Environmental Protection Division

Wastewater Permitting The Environmental Protection Division (EPD), Wastewater Regulatory Program has been delegated the authority by the Environmental Protection Agency (EPA) to administer permits for the treatment and disposal of domestic and industrial wastewater under the Clean Water Act.

Wastewater Discharges from Water Treatment Plants: Am I,

27-09-2021· There are two types of permits available: the Individual Permit and the Water Treatment Plant General Permit TXG640000. You may qualify for coverage under the Water Treatment Plant General Permit TXG640000 if your facility generates wastewater as a result of conventional water treatment.

Water treatment plants - Washington State Department of,

01-09-2019· We have developed the Water Treatment Plant General Permit (WTPGP) to help treatment facilities comply with state laws and the Federal Water Pollution Control Act. This permit contains specific requirements and conditions for permittees to protect rivers and other waterbodies that receive wastewater discharges.

Operating permits for drinking water systems :: Washington,

Water Systems Operating Under a Red Permit. A Red operating permit category indicates that the water system is inadequate. This could result in building permits, on-site sewage disposal permits, food service permits, liquor licenses and other permits or licenses being denied for properties connected to or to be connected to the water system.
